West Ham fans react as Grady Diangana completes move to West Brom
West Ham attacker Grady Diangana has completed a permanent move to Premier League rivals West Brom – and some of the club’s supporters on Twitter are raging at the announcement.
The Hammers have confirmed on their that the 22-year-old has made a move to the Hawthorns, where he enjoyed a successful loan spell last season.
Newly-promoted West Brom have he’s signed a five-year deal with them and he’s done so after playing a major role last season in their promotion from the Championship.
The English winger scored eight goals and made seven assists in the league, as they finished second in the second-tier and earned the right to be back in the top-flight.
He’s a skilful winger that has come through the academy ranks at West Ham, but he will now be playing his senior football in the West Midlands and appears to have found a club that are a big fan of him.

A selection of West Ham supporters on social media were furious that the youngster has been allowed, as they would have loved to seen him integrated to their first-team in the new season.
The rapid wide player did manage 22 senior games for the Hammers before his loan exit and the club have now decided to cash in on him.
